Age Band Guide… What to Do First

Age bandMust‑do highlightsHelpful notes
6 to 36 monthsBabies & Tots Nursery drop off, Surfside Baby Bay splash zone, stroller loops on the Royal PromenadeNursery is staffed and space is limited… check hours and fees in the app. Program overview: Babies & Tots. Swim diapers are only allowed in splash areas, not regular pools.
3 to 5Adventure Ocean age group sessions, Surfside Splashaway Bay, Surfside carousel, Lemon Post mocktails with grownupsKids must be toilet trained for Adventure Ocean. Program overview and age splits are on the youth page: Adventure Ocean.
6 to 8Adventure Ocean activities, Lost Dunes mini golf, beginner ice skating sessions at Absolute Zero during public skate times, Surfside splash timeCheck daily schedule for skate session age guidance and closed toe sock requirements. Ice arena page: Absolute Zero. Mini golf info: Lost Dunes.
9 to 12Adventure Ocean older group, FlowRider bodyboarding, mini golf rematch, family show at AquaDomeFlowRider details and lesson options: FlowRider. Show reservations open in the app.
13 to 17Social 020 teen hangout, Category 6 slides, FlowRider stand up sessions, Absolute Zero skate, select thrill add onsHeight rules apply at Category 6. The official family guide notes 48 to 52 inches depending on slide. Waterpark page: Category 6. Teen hub: Social 020.

Note Exact age splits and session times can vary by sailing. The Royal app shows the latest.

Tips for Parents

  • Check height early. If a rider is close to the mark, measure at the waterpark before you queue. Royal’s family guide notes a 48 to 52 inch range by slide.
  • Pack the right swimwear. Swim diapers are allowed only in splash zones, not in regular pools.
  • Reserve shows. Open the app on embarkation day to grab prime times for AquaDome and the ice show.
  • Tag and meet. Give older kids a set check in time at Social 020 or a Surfside bench.
  • Consider add ons. Thrill extras and private lessons can be booked in the Cruise Planner.

FAQ

Is Category 6 included Yes… there is no extra fee for entry. Height rules apply and vary by slide. See the waterpark overview: Category 6.
What are the youth program ages Nursery is 6 to 36 months. Adventure Ocean covers children starting around age 3 and up through preteen groups. Teens have Social 020 for ages 13 to 17. Overview: Kids and Teens.
Do I need reservations for shows Most AquaDome and ice shows use reservations through the app. Same day standby lines are sometimes available.
Can little kids skate Public skate sessions list age and gear rules in the app. Check Absolute Zero schedule on board.
